As the world grapples with the persistent challenges of infectious diseases, the emergence of antiviral resistance has become a pressing concern for global health authorities. Antivirals, compounds designed to inhibit the replication of viruses, have long been hailed as a crucial tool in the fight against viral infections. However, the ever-evolving nature of viruses has led to the development of resistance mechanisms, rendering some of these once-effective treatments less potent or even ineffective.
The implications of this growing phenomenon are far-reaching and multifaceted. At the forefront, antiviral resistance can compromise the ability of healthcare systems to effectively manage and contain viral outbreaks. Viruses that are resistant to available treatments can continue to spread, leading to prolonged illnesses, increased hospitalizations, and even higher mortality rates. This poses a significant challenge for public health authorities tasked with mitigating the impact of infectious diseases on populations.
Moreover, the emergence of antiviral resistance has the potential to exacerbate existing healthcare disparities, particularly in resource-limited settings. As new, more effective antivirals are often more expensive, access to these crucial medications may be limited for populations with limited financial means or inadequate healthcare infrastructure. This could further widen the gap between developed and developing nations, undermining efforts to achieve global health equity.
The challenges posed by antiviral resistance extend beyond the immediate impact on patient outcomes. The development of resistance can also compromise the ability of healthcare systems to respond effectively to future pandemics or outbreaks. As viruses evolve to evade current treatment options, the need for continuous innovation and the development of new antivirals becomes increasingly urgent. This places a significant burden on research and development efforts, as well as on the regulatory processes required to bring new therapies to market.
Furthermore, the rise of antiviral resistance raises concerns about the overall sustainability of healthcare systems. The increased need for more potent and costly treatments, coupled with the potential for prolonged illnesses and higher hospitalization rates, can strain the financial resources of healthcare providers and governments. This, in turn, can lead to difficult decisions regarding resource allocation, potentially compromising the accessibility and quality of care for other medical conditions.
In light of these challenges, global health experts have emphasized the importance of a multi-faceted approach to address the threat of antiviral resistance. This includes enhanced surveillance and monitoring systems to detect emerging resistance patterns, increased investment in research and development for novel antiviral therapies, and the implementation of comprehensive antimicrobial stewardship programs to promote the responsible use of existing antivirals.
